Output 998216392e9c18bd97c237cee358d2bb1ee33f3480d066b73c9b9bcc82610681:2

value
670095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c4cfe3983526e02cbc5d7bd594714362e0c7bec OP_EQUAL
address
3JrfCBPAS3VZAHygsQF9NZPFzKJtyA8Biy
transaction
998216392e9c18bd97c237cee358d2bb1ee33f3480d066b73c9b9bcc82610681
spent
true